With a pattern that is both representational and stylized, the 20″ Arrowhead shade has a distinct arts and crafts appeal. The arrowhead plant is found in shallow wetlands, which places this design firmly in the water plant group of Tiffany Studios shade designs. The distinctive leaves for which the plant is named reach toward the top of the shade. Delicate white flowers populate the spaces between the leaves. The decorative borders at the bottom of the shade reinforce the arts and crafts motif. This example was commissioned in 2005 by an out of state client. The pottery base was custom made for this shade by Ephraim Pottery.
